Output 7049e5349e899c161676323b5731e390d829d16c20d6a9c5e796fbc46938bb35:2

value
26620204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6958c922a28bca898a31836b1aef07aadf87c00c OP_EQUAL
address
MHWBYWXaWRJkRBUHT6TjkBLbhqaUWp2PLk
transaction
7049e5349e899c161676323b5731e390d829d16c20d6a9c5e796fbc46938bb35
spent
true